Question #251689

A car travelling at a speed of 50 mph. The driver saw a roadblock 80m ahead and stepped on the brake causing the car to decelerate uniformly at 10 m/s². Find the distance from the roadblock to the point where the car stopped. Assume perception reaction time is 2 seconds.
